python中print函数的用法详解

64次阅读
没有评论

共计 942 个字符,预计需要花费 3 分钟才能阅读完成。

在 Python 中,print 函数是用来在控制台输出信息的函数。它的基本用法是将要输出的内容作为参数传递给 print 函数。以下是 print 函数的详细用法解释:

  1. 基本用法:

    print(value1, value2, ..., sep=' ', end='\n', file=sys.stdout, flush=False)
    
    • value1, value2, …: 要输出的值,可以是一个或多个参数。
    • sep: 用于分隔每个参数的字符串,默认为一个空格。
    • end: 输出行的结尾字符,默认为换行符\n
    • file: 输出的文件对象,默认为标准输出流 sys.stdout。
    • flush: 是否立即刷新输出,默认为 False。
  2. 输出字符串:

    print('Hello, World!')
    

    输出:Hello, World!

  3. 输出变量:

    name = 'Alice'
    age = 25
    print('Name:', name, 'Age:', age)
    

    输出:Name: Alice Age: 25

  4. 格式化输出:

    name = 'Bob'
    age = 30
    print('Name: {}, Age: {}'.format(name, age))
    

    输出:Name: Bob, Age: 30

  5. 分隔符和结尾符:

    print('apple', 'banana', 'orange', sep=', ', end='!')
    

    输出:apple, banana, orange!

  6. 输出到文件:

    with open('output.txt', 'w') as f:
        print('Hello, File!', file=f)
    

    Hello, File! 输出到名为 output.txt 的文件中。

  7. 刷新输出:

    import time
    
    for i in range(10):
        print(i, end=' ', flush=True)
        time.sleep(1)
    

    每隔一秒输出一个数字,使用 flush=True 立即刷新输出。

丸趣 TV 网 – 提供最优质的资源集合!

正文完
 
丸趣
版权声明:本站原创文章,由 丸趣 2024-02-05发表,共计942字。
转载说明:除特殊说明外本站除技术相关以外文章皆由网络搜集发布,转载请注明出处。
评论(没有评论)